Red Pepper Soup with Toasted Cumin Seeds - PCOS-Friendly Recipe
This Red Pepper Soup with Toasted Cumin Seeds is a PCOS-friendly recipe.
Nutrition per Serving
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ons grapeseed oil
- 1 small red onion, chopped
- 2 tablespoons grated fresh garlic
- 1 tablespoon garam masala
- 1 teaspoon asafoetida*
- 1 teaspoon mustard seeds
- 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
- 1 teaspoon Spanish paprika
- 3 red peppers, seeds removed and peppers sliced
- 1/2 cup organic vegetable broth
- 1/2 cup white wine
- Pinch salt and freshly ground black pepper
- 1 tablespoon cumin seeds
- *Can be found at specialty Asian and Indian markets.
